Frederick Lane 1805–1872 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 04 Dec 1805

Birth Location: Gouchland, Virginia, United States

Death Date: 4 Mar 1872

Death Location: Ralls, Missouri

Father: John Layne

Mother: Mary Crafton

Spouse(s): Helen Ellis

Children(s): Mary Layne, James Layne, William Layne

Frederick Lane was born in 1805 in Gouchland, Virginia, United States, the child of John Thomas Layne And Mary Polly Crafton. Frederick Lane married Helen Ellen Ellis, and had children including James Morgan Layne, Mary Amanda Layne, William Henry Layne. Frederick Lane passed away in 1872 in Ralls, Missouri.
